a positively charged test object is moving toward the positive source charge in an electric field. a. its potential energy decreases b. its potential energy increases c. its potential energy stays the same d. its potential energy becomes negative
Consider the equation for electric potential energy:\[U=\frac{1}{4 \pi \epsilon_{0}}\frac{q_{1}q_{2}}{r}\] You can see that if q1 and q2 are positive, the energy is going to be positive. This eliminates answer (d). More importantly, let's look at the relationship of U with r:\[U \varpropto\frac{1}{r}\] Since U is dependent on r, this eliminates answer (c). With this relationship, if r is decreased then U is going to increase. I would therefore choose answer (b).
